A football game consists of four quarters. Each quarter lasts for 15 minutes. Total game time amounts To 60 minutes. Teams aim for longest total score. Halftime occurs after two quarters. This break allows players & coaches time for adjustments. Time stops for various situations like injuries or timeouts. This affects total game duration.

What Are Overtime Quarters?

In games where regulation time concludes without a definitive winner. Overtime quarters are utilized. NFL rules dictate overtime periods. Allowing teams a final chance for victory. Overtime rules differ significantly from regular quarters. Often intensifying competition further.

In NFL overtime. Each team receives an opportunity for possession after kickoff. If initial scoring drive occurs. Opposing team still gets chance To possess ball. Such structure ensures fairness & maximizes excitement for fans.

College football employs a unique set of rules for overtime. Each team starts with a possession at opponentโ€™s 25yard line. This format promotes aggressive play & scoring opportunities throughout games. Understanding significant differences reinforces comprehension of overall structure.

The TwoMinute Warning

A twominute warning presents both an opportunity & a challenge near end of games. This stoppage occurs when two minutes remain in either half. Coaches use this time To convey crucial instructions & evaluate game strategies.

How long is each quarter in a football game?

Each quarter in a football game is 15 minutes long. Making The total game time 60 minutes.

How many quarters are there in a football game?

There are four quarters in a standard football game.

What happens if The score is tied at The end of four quarters?

If The score is tied at The end of four quarters. The game goes into overtime To determine a winner.

How long is halftime in a football game?

Halftime occurs after The second quarter & lasts about 12 minutes in professional games.

Can a quarter end without a play being completed?

Yes. A quarter can end when The game clock reaches zero. Even if The play is still in progress.
